書店様へのご案内
図書館様へのご案内
よくある質問
訂正とダウンロード
お問い合わせ
電子書籍一覧
デザイン・グラフィック
素材集・フォント集
イラスト・アニメ
3DCG・映像
Web制作
プログラミング
IT・ビジネス
写真技法・カメラ
写真集
美術・建築
生活・趣味・実用
カレンダー・手帳・年賀状
料理の本棚
その他
MdN Pickup news
MdNからのお知らせ
月刊MdNバックナンバー
プレスリリース
MdNユーザー会員 ログイン
FAQ
プライバシーポリシー
会社概要
採用情報
会員規約
利用規約
閉じる
デザイン・グラフィック
素材集・フォント集
イラスト・アニメ
3DCG・映像
Web制作
プログラミング
IT・ビジネス
写真技法・カメラ
写真集
美術・建築
生活・趣味・実用
カレンダー・手帳・年賀状
料理の本棚
その他
Web制作
Webデザイン
HTML5+CSS3の新しい教科書 改訂新版 基礎から覚える、深く理解できる。
試し読み
HTML5+CSS3の新しい教科書 改訂新版 基礎から覚える、深く理解できる。
こもり まさあき 監修/赤間 公太郎 著/原 一宣。 著
定価 2,750円
(本体 2,500円+税10%)
※電子書籍の価格は各販売ストアにてご確認ください。
紙の本を買う
紙の書籍を購入
Amazon
ヨドバシ.com
電子版を買う
電子書籍版を購入
Kindle
honto
楽天kobo
ヨドバシ.com
発売日
:
2018-08-27
仕様
:
B5判/272P
ISBN
:
978-4-8443-6783-3
内容紹介
目次
お問い合せ
Web制作のプロを目指す方に向けて、HTML5+CSS3を使ったWebサイトの作り方を解説した入門書の改訂版。12章構成で、インターネットとWebサイトの仕組みに始まり、サイト制作現場の基本的な作業フロー、HTMLによるマークアップ方法、CSSによる装飾・レイアウトの技法をていねいに解説しています。最終章では、レスポンシブWebデザインに対応したサンプルサイトを題材に、実際の業務により近い形の制作方法を学ぶことができる実践的な内容です。 本書の一番の特長は、HTMLとCSSの使い方、サイトの作り方を説明するだけではなく、「なぜ、そのように作るのか?」といった「背景」や「理由」にも踏み込んで解説している点です。スマートフォンやタブレットなどの普及により、Web制作の現場はこの数年で新たな転換期を迎えていますが、基本となる知識と技法をきちんと押さえておかなければ、いま・これからの新しい流れに対応することも、それを応用することもできません。本書は、そうした新しい時代にも対応できるような基本知識と応用の効く制作技法を伝えることを目指した本です。
■ページ見本
目次
------------------------------------------------------------
Lesson 1 Webサイトの構造を理解する
------------------------------------------------------------
01 Webサイトが表示される仕組み
02 Webページは何でできている?
03 HTMLの役割とバージョン
04 CSSの機能と役割
05 HTMLを作成するための専用アプリケーション
06 Web制作に利用するアプリケーション
07 Webブラウザの役割と種類
08 Webページの構造を見てみよう
------------------------------------------------------------
Lesson 2 制作に入る前の準備
------------------------------------------------------------
01 Webページができるまでの流れ
02 Webサイトのファイルを整理して格納する
03 ファイルとフォルダのネーミング
04 Webブラウザが持つデフォルトのスタイル
05 Webサイト制作で使う単位
------------------------------------------------------------
Lesson 3 HTMLでページの骨格をつくる
------------------------------------------------------------
01 head要素とbody要素
02 head要素の書き方
03 body要素内に配置される要素の構造と性質
04 HTMLにCSSを組み込む
05 ページの情報を伝えるmeta要素
--------------------------------------------------
Lesson 4 HTML&CSSの基本ルール
--------------------------------------------------
01 HTMLの基本ルール
02 マークアップとはどんなもの?
03 マークアップの実例を見てみよう
04 CSSの基本ルール
05 よく使うセレクタを知る
06 疑似クラスと疑似要素
07 セレクタを使った実例
------------------------------------------------------------
Lesson 5 文字・見出し・段落の設計
------------------------------------------------------------
01 基本になる文字サイズを決める
02 文字の単位はどれを選ぶ?
03 文字の行間を調整する
04 書体を決める
05 文字に色をつける
06 見出しのスタイルとジャンプ率
07 連続した見出しのマージンを効率よく調整する
08 読みやすい段落の設定
09 段落の「字下げ」を表現する
10 文章の両端揃えと字間の調節
------------------------------------------------------------
Lesson 6 リンクと画像の設定
------------------------------------------------------------
01 テキストリンクの色を設定する
02 ブロック別にリンクの色を変える
03 Webサイトで使う画像の形式
04 画像をCSSで装飾する
05 画像にリンクを設定する
06 CSSのみでボタンを作成する
------------------------------------------------------------
Lesson 7 リストとテーブルを組む
------------------------------------------------------------
01 リストはどんな場所で使う?
02 ul 要素とol 要素の使い分け
03 リストマークを変更する
04 複雑なリストを表現する
05 対になる情報をリストで表現
06 テーブルの基本構造
07 表組みにキャプションをつける
08 セルを結合する
------------------------------------------------------------
Lesson 8 ナビゲーションをつくる
------------------------------------------------------------
01 ナビゲーションの役割を考える
02 レスポンシブデザインにおけるナビゲーションの基本
03 Flexboxを使ったナビゲーション
04 リンクエリアを広げる
05 下層ページをメニュー表示するドロップダウンメニュー
06 パンくずナビゲーション
------------------------------------------------------------
Lesson 9 フォームをつくる
------------------------------------------------------------
01 フォームの仕組みと構成するパーツ
02 フォームを使いやすく工夫する
03 フォームをマークアップする要素
04 HTML5で強化されたtype属性
05 フレームワークを利用してフォームを装飾する
------------------------------------------------------------
Lesson 10 Webページをレイアウトする
------------------------------------------------------------
01 ボックスモデルを理解する
02 レイアウトの考え方と設計
03 要素をグループ化する
04 コメントアウトを活用する
05 floatプロパティの性質とclearfixを使うポイント
06 境界線と余白を調整する
07 positionを使ったレイアウト
08 Flexboxを使ったレイアウト
------------------------------------------------------------
Lesson 11 HTML5+CSS3の新機能
------------------------------------------------------------
01 HTML5で新しく加わった機能や要素
02 ページのセクショニングに関連する要素
03 CSS3で加わったプロパティ
04 CSS3で加わった疑似クラス
05 複雑なグラデーションを簡単に表現する
06 フレームワークを利用してWeb制作の効率を上げる
------------------------------------------------------------
Lesson 12 実践編:レスポンシブサイトをつくる
------------------------------------------------------------
01 コーディングに入る前の準備
02 共通化できるHTMLを作成する
03 レスポンシブWebデザインのCSSを記述する
04 トップページをつくる
05 「About」ページをつくる
06 「News」ページをつくる
07 「Contact」ページをつくる
巻末:用語索引
tweet
シェア
はてブ
あわせてよく検索される書籍
プロフェッショナルから学ぶ! デザイン・グラフィック書
現場で役立つ! MdNのスキルアップ書籍
絵が上手くなる! イラスト強化ブック